Pine Bluff teen in critical condition after shooting

PINE BLUFF, Ark. (AP)   Police in Pine Bluff say a 14-year-old boy remains in critical condition after he was shot while unlocking the front door of his grandmother’s home.

Police said Monday that the boy was an “innocent bystander” after a gunman in a vehicle opened fire on another vehicle nearby. The boy’s grandmother told police that her grandson was unlocking the front door when she heard shots being fired from across the street.

Authorities also discovered a wrecked vehicle near the scene of the shooting. That driver told police that someone opened fire on his vehicle, which caused him to crash. He was not hit by gunfire or seriously hurt in the wreck.

Pine Bluff police said the shooting occurred Wednesday, but no arrests have been made.
